About the Authors
  

   

MARIE-HÉLÈNE LIZOTTE  
 
Mother of three and holder of a bachelor’s degree in psych-education (University of Sherbrooke, 1988) and a D.E.C. in Arts and Letters. Herwork experience includes helping intellectually challenged adults aswell as children indaycare.  Presently she is working as a special education teacher for intellectually challenged children and for children with developmental problems (such as autism) with or without an intellectual handicap.  
MICHEL POIRIER  
 
Father of a girl, now an adult, a teacher since1976, and holder of a bachelor’s degree specializing in education for children with special needs (University of Quebec in Montreal, 1984). He has worked with physically challenged people and adolescents with social problems. Presently he works with the intellectually challenged or those with developmental problems (such as autism) with or without an intellectual handicap.
